Smith College is looking for a qualified after school program instructor to plan and manage engaging activities for students from kindergarten to sixth grade. You will supervise students, implement positive behavioral strategies, and maintain daily schedules and supplies.
Qualifications include an Associate’s Degree in education or a related field, along with experience leading elementary students. The role offers a pay range of $18–22 per hour, based on individual qualifications, and a competitive benefits package.
